Option Care Health (NASDAQ:OPCH – Free Report) had its price target hoisted by Barrington Research from $38.00 to $40.00 in a research report sent to investors on Thursday, Benzinga reports. The firm currently has an outperform rating on the stock.
Separately, JMP Securities initiated coverage on shares of Option Care Health in a report on Tuesday, July 16th. They issued an outperform rating and a $36.00 price objective for the company.

Option Care Health (NASDAQ:OPCH –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, July 31st. The company reported $0.30 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.27 by $0.03. Option Care Health had a net margin of 4.60% and a return on equity of 14.82%. The business had revenue of $1.23 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$1.17 billion. During the same period last year, the business posted $0.63 earnings per share. Option Care Health’s quarterly revenue was up 14.8% compared to the same quarter last year. As a group, equities research analysts expect that Option Care Health will post 1.21 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

About Option Care Health
Option Care Health, Inc offers home and alternate site infusion services in the United States. The company provides anti-infective therapies; home infusion services to treat heart failures; home parenteral nutrition and enteral nutrition support services for numerous acute and chronic conditions, such as stroke, cancer, and gastrointestinal diseases; immunoglobulin infusion therapies for the treatment of immune deficiencies; and treatments for chronic inflammatory disorders, including crohn's disease, plaque psoriasis, psoriatic arthritis, rheumatoid arthritis, ulcerative colitis, and other chronic inflammatory disorders.
